On April 16, there was a party for Elton John. They brought in co-owners Elmer Valentine, Lou Adler, Mario Maglieri and others, opening in late March with a Buddah Records party for NRBQ. The restaurant was founded in early 1972 by Gary Stromberg and Bob Gibson, heads of the PR firm Gibson & Stromberg. The restaurant is next to The Roxy Theatre and 1 OAK formerly Gazzarri's, Billboard Live, and The Key Club. Upstairs is an exclusive club called "Over the Rainbow", which consists of a full bar, a dance floor, and a DJ booth. ![]() The bottom level of the building is the restaurant, The Rainbow Bar and Grill. The Rainbow Bar and Grill is a bar, restaurant and grocery store on the Sunset Strip in West Hollywood, California, United States, adjacent to the border of Beverly Hills, California.
